How are cases of school violence and harassment crimes resolved in Mexico?

Cases of school violence and bullying in Mexico are investigated and resolved by educational authorities and state prosecutors, depending on the nature of the incident. The General Education Law establishes that educational institutions must promote an environment of respectful coexistence free of violence. Victims of school violence and bullying can file complaints with school authorities and, in serious cases, with legal authorities. It seeks to prevent and punish violence in schools and promote the safety and well-being of students. Additionally, some states in Mexico have implemented specific laws to address bullying, also known as bullying.

What are the financing options available for small and medium-sized businesses (SMEs) in Mexico?

Mexico In Mexico, SMEs have financing options such as bank loans, government programs, venture capital investment, collective financing (crowdfunding) and access to support programs through institutions such as Nacional Financiera (NAFIN) and the National Institute of the Entrepreneur (INADEM).

What are the labor regulations related to the hiring of foreign workers in Guatemala, and what requirements must be met to ensure legal and fair hiring?

The hiring of foreign workers in Guatemala is subject to specific regulations. Employers wishing to hire foreign workers must comply with visa and work permit requirements. In addition, they must ensure that foreign workers have adequate working conditions and are not exploited. Immigration authorities supervise and regulate the hiring of foreign workers. These regulations seek to ensure that the hiring of foreign workers is done legally and fairly.
